This Week's Crypto Watchlist|Jupiter, NEAR, Jito, and 7 Other Projects are Active. Understand Who's Worth Monitoring with a 'Catalyst Calendar'

This week brings a concentrated wave of catalysts for several crypto projects, based on a schedule compiled by an analyst. Jupiter (JUP) leads by launching a private testnet for its GUM unified market on July 6th, aiming to aggregate diverse assets on Solana. On July 7th, NEAR hosts a major livestream reveal focused on enterprise "black box" tech, likely detailing its SPICE upgrade. Also on July 7th-8th, Berachain executes its largest mainnet upgrade, "PoL Next," simplifying its tokenomics by retiring the BGT token and consolidating value into BERA. Zcash (ZEC) eyes recovery with its critical Ironwood network upgrade slated for July 21st, designed to restore trust after a recent privacy vulnerability scare. Looking ahead, Lighter (LIT) plans to launch tokenized stocks next week, leveraging its key position as the default perpetual DEX on the new Robinhood Chain. Jito (JTO) is rumored to launch its JTX trading platform in mid-July, targeting professional traders and promising substantial protocol revenue sharing. Lastly, Ether.fi (ETHFI) has proposed deploying a dedicated Aave V4 instance to power its EtherFi Cash Visa card, though this remains in the early governance stage. The week presents a mix of product launches, major upgrades, and strategic expansions, each carrying its own potential for momentum and associated risks like token unlocks or execution challenges.

From "Heaven-Sent Public Chain" to "Heaven-Forsaken Public Chain": What Led to the Collapse of Berachain?

Once hailed as a "top-tier public chain," Berachain has seen a dramatic decline, with its new nickname "doomed chain" reflecting its severe downturn. Launched in February 2025 with an innovative Proof-of-Liquidity (PoL) consensus mechanism aimed at boosting DeFi efficiency, the project initially attracted significant interest. Its TVL surged to $3.3 billion, with over 140,000 active addresses. However, the ecosystem quickly deteriorated. TVL has since collapsed to $180 million, and the chain’s daily revenue dropped to just $84. The sharp decline is attributed to several critical issues. The tokenomics heavily favored venture capitalists (VCs), who received 34.31% of the total token supply, while retail participants received minimal allocations. This high Fully Diluted Valuation (FDV) and low circulating supply model led to artificial price spikes followed by a steep crash—BERA fell from a high of $9 to around $0.7, a drop of over 90%. Internal challenges also mounted. The foundation cut most of its retail-focused marketing team and saw key developers, including the chief developer, leave. Community trust eroded further when a Balancer protocol vulnerability forced a network halt in November 2025. Additionally, major token unlocks are scheduled starting February 2026, with 12.16% of supply—including significant VC holdings—set to be released, likely increasing selling pressure. Despite attempts at strategic shifts, including a partnership to use BERA as a reserve asset, the project faces intense community criticism and a loss of developer interest, with many moving to competing chains. The foundation has admitted that its "retail-first" strategy was ineffective, and if given another chance, it would not have sold so many tokens to VCs.
